Transaction 42aad70b341129d71ab6800f9eb93295518224ed5b6f824d0d49512e14d9e6ce

2 Input
1 Outputs
  • 42aad70b341129d71ab6800f9eb93295518224ed5b6f824d0d49512e14d9e6ce:0
  • value  898926
    address  14YA8YaY2tbFvASd4bUgLds6Q1rmWbeLBk